Full Description

At NC 94782045 and NC 94832046, in a gently-shelving southerly-facing hillside, are two hut-circles, A and B respectively, in association with a minor field system. This last extends discontinuously along and up the hill-side in a west north-westerly direction for perhaps 200 metres from the more sheltered situation of the huts. The field system lacks the usually accompanying field clearance mounds and is only denoted by lynchets, some well-defined and lengthy, and occasional wasted field banks, the latter in some instances seeming to overlay the former. One plot between the huts is discernible, 35.0m by 20.0m.
'A' only remains a peat-silted platform, about 12.0m diameter plainly edged on the N arc by the scarp formed in the levelling into the slope. 'B', set into the slope and completely heather-covered, is 9.5m diameter inside a much reduced wall vaguely spread to 1.5m; an entrance is possibly from the S arc.
Surveyed at 1:10 560.
Visited by OS (J M) 16 December 1976
